7-Day Zone Forecast for Smyth County (Text-Only)
NWS Forecast for: Smyth County
Issued by: National Weather Service Blacksburg, VA
Last Update: 703 PM EDT Fri Jul 18 2025




Rest Of Tonight: Mostly cloudy. A chance of showers and thunderstorms, mainly this evening. Patchy fog. Some thunderstorms may produce heavy rainfall this evening. Lows in the upper 60s. Southwest winds around 5 mph. Chance of rain 50 percent.

Saturday: Mostly cloudy. A chance of showers and thunderstorms in the morning, then showers and thunderstorms likely in the afternoon. Humid with highs in the lower 80s. West winds 5 to 10 mph. Chance of rain 70 percent.

Saturday Night: Mostly cloudy. Showers and thunderstorms likely in the evening, then a chance of showers after midnight. Humid with lows in the upper 60s. West winds 5 to 10 mph. Chance of rain 70 percent.

Sunday: Mostly cloudy. A chance of showers in the morning, then showers likely with a chance of thunderstorms in the afternoon. Humid with highs in the lower 80s. West winds 5 to 10 mph. Chance of rain 70 percent.

Sunday Night: Mostly cloudy. Showers likely with a chance of thunderstorms in the evening, then a chance of showers after midnight. Humid with lows in the upper 60s. West winds 5 to 10 mph. Chance of rain 70 percent.

Monday And Monday Night: Mostly cloudy with showers likely with a chance of thunderstorms. Highs in the lower 80s. Lows in the mid 60s. Chance of rain 70 percent.

Tuesday And Tuesday Night: Mostly cloudy. Showers likely with a chance of thunderstorms. Highs in the lower 80s. Lows in the mid 60s. Chance of rain 60 percent.

Wednesday Through Friday: Partly cloudy with a chance of showers and thunderstorms. Highs in the mid 80s. Lows in the mid 60s. Chance of rain 40 percent.
